基于IEEE 802.15.4的车辆间通信系统硬件设计 被引量:2

Hardware Design of Inter-vehicle Communication System Based on IEEE 802.15.4

摘要 将IEEE 802.15.4应用于车辆间通信系统中,对IEEE 802.15.4协议和射频芯片进行了介绍,提出了基于IEEE 802.15.4的车辆间通信系统硬件系统设计方案,分析了与硬件系统设计相关的系统参数,在系统参数指导下对硬件进行了实施,经实际环境测试表明本硬件系统设计的正确性。 The protocol of IEEE 802.15.4 was applied to the inter-vehicle communication systems.The protocol of IEEE 802.15.4 and RF-chip were introduced and the scheme of hardware design in inter-vehicle communication systems based on IEEE 802.15.4 was proposed.The related parameters of the hardware-system design were analyzed.The system was implemented under the guidance of the system parameters and the hardware design was proved to be correct in the actual environmental testing.
